The climate of Satu Mare

Situated in Romania, Satu Mare possesses a marine west coast climate, identified as Cfb in the Köppen climate classification. This distinct climate encompasses moderate temperatures throughout the year and rainfall exceeding evaporation figures all year long. Primarily, temperature highs vary from 1°C (33.8°F) in January to a balmy 25°C (77°F) in July and August. Conversely, lows range from -5°C (23°F) in January to 13°C (55.4°F) in July and August.

Rainfall in Satu Mare distributes relatively evenly across the year, however, higher precipitation rates are observed in the months of May through August. During these months, levels of rainfall are typically around 70mm (2.76") to 80mm (3.15"). Remaining months see about 20mm (0.79") to 40mm (1.57") of rainfall. The daylight hours exhibit a prominent shift from 8.5 hours in December, ultimately peaking at 15.9 hours in June.

Unique weather patterns can be observed in this region. July and August are the warmest months, each with a similar high of 25°C (77°F), but August claims the highest nighttime temperature with 13°C (55.4°F). January holds the record for the coolest month, having the lowest high and low temperatures, 1°C (33.8°F) and -5°C (23°F) respectively.

The best time to visit Satu Mare

Considering all weather elements, the prime time for tourists to visit Satu Mare is from June to September. During these months, temperature highs oscillate between 20°C (68°F) and 25°C (77°F) and lows vary between 9°C (48.2°F) and 13°C (55.4°F). Along with more agreeable temperatures, these months offer the longest daylight periods, fluctuating around 15 hours, which provides delightful tiime for sightseeing and exploration. Although observing the highest rainfall statistics, the amount of precipitation throughout these months should not heavily affect most outdoor activities.

The worst time to visit Satu Mare

Visitors might find journeing less agreeable from November to February. These months boast the lowest temperatures, encompassing highs from 1°C (33.8°F) to 7°C (44.6°F) and lows from -5°C (23°F) to 0°C (32°F). Additionally, daylight hours are at their shortest duration, oscillating between 8.5 hours in December to 10.3 hours in February, reducing opportunities for outdoor pursuits. Despite lower rain statistics, the combination of cold climate and decreased daylight might pose discomfort.

Spring weather in Satu Mare

Spring in Satu Mare spans from March to May. During this season, the high temperature rises from 10°C (50°F) to 20°C (68°F) and the low elevates from 1°C (33.8°F) to 9°C (48.2°F). Patterns in rainfall reveal a surge, especially in May, from 20mm (0.79") in March to a peak of 70mm (2.76"). Corresponding with the rise in temperatures, daylight hours also experience an ascent from 11.9 hours in March to 15.2 hours in May.

Summer weather in Satu Mare

Summer, extending from June to August, delivers the highest temperatures of the year. During this period, highs and lows fluctuate around 22°C (71.6°F) to 25°C (77°F) and 12°C (53.6°F) to 13°C (55.4°F), respectively. Rainfall levels are also at their zenith, with each summer month noting around 70mm (2.76") to 80mm (3.15") of precipitation. Despite the peak in rainfall, daylight hours also reach a jublilant apex of nearly 15.6 to 15.9 hours.

Autumn weather in Satu Mare

Autumn in Satu Mare begins in September and concludes in November. On this route, high and low temperatures see a steep decline, descending from 21°C (69.8°F) to 7°C (44.6°F) and from 10°C (50°F) to 0°C (32°F) respectively. Parallel to the drop in percentages, rainfall descends from 40mm (1.57") to 30mm (1.18"). A decrease in daylight hours from 12.6 hours to 9.3 hours yields shorter days during this period.

Winter weather in Satu Mare

Winter months, December to February, are the coldest in Satu Mare. High temperatures tumble to 1°C (33.8°F) to 3°C (37.4°F), while the low nosedives to -5°C (23°F) to -3°C (26.6°F). Also, rainfall reduces to 20mm (0.79") for each of these winter months. Coupled with the frosty weather, daylight hours plummet to the shortest duration between 8.5 hours in December to 10.3 hours in February, dropping significantly from other seasons.

Frequently asked questions

What are the coldest months in Satu Mare?

The coldest temperatures in Satu Mare, Romania, occur during January, when averages reach a peak of 1°C (33.8°F) and a low of -5°C (23°F).

What is the driest month in Satu Mare?

January through March and December are months with the least rain in Satu Mare, Romania, when 20mm (0.79") of rain is typically aggregated.

How much does it rain in Satu Mare?

Throughout the year, 530mm (20.87") of rain is accumulated.

What is the rainiest month in Satu Mare?

The wettest months in Satu Mare, Romania, are June and July, with an average 80mm (3.15") of rainfall.

When are the longest days in Satu Mare?

June has the longest days of the year in Satu Mare, with an average of 15h and 54min of daylight.

What are the warmest months in Satu Mare?

Satu Mare's warmest period falls in July and August, when the average high-temperatures ascend to 25°C (77°F).

When is Daylight Saving Time (DST) in Satu Mare?

On Sunday, 27. October 2024, at 04:00, Daylight Saving Time ends, and the time zone changes from EEST to EET. The next Daylight Saving Time starts on Sunday, 30. March 2025, at 03:00, and the time zone reverts from EET to EEST.

What is the month with the shortest days in Satu Mare?

The month with the shortest days in Satu Mare is December, with an average of 8h and 30min of daylight.
